Planting - We recommend using onion sets, which can be planted without worry of frost damage and have a higher success rate than planting from onion seeds or transplants.

They develop into a full-size bulb after about 3-½ months.

Harvesting at the end of the summer or in autumn when the leaves are dry and yellow
